Logo
Cloudflare

Database Reliability Engineer

Cloudflare, Washington, District of Columbia, us, 20022

Save Job

Overview

Join to apply for the

Systems Engineer - Database Platform

role at

Cloudflare . About Cloudflare: we help build a better Internet. Cloudflare runs one of the world’s largest networks that powers millions of websites and Internet properties. We protect and accelerate Internet applications without requiring hardware, software installations, or code changes. Cloudflare is recognized for its culture and innovation. Available Locations

Available locations include Austin, TX; Washington, DC. About the Department

The Database Platform Team, within Cloudflare's Infrastructure Engineering, builds and operates databases at scale. The team’s mission is to empower internal engineering teams, delivering products quickly and reliably through automated, scalable data infrastructure. We automate database infrastructure, strengthen resiliency, and enable applications to scale, reducing operational complexities for database management. This role offers the opportunity to develop new features, integrate with database tooling, and advance automation across our platform. What You’ll Do

You will work with database engineers, software developers, and Infrastructure teams to evolve database platform architecture, access control, and automation strategies. You will help enhance PostgreSQL infrastructure, improve database reliability, automation, and tooling. If you are passionate about PostgreSQL, automation, and database tooling, we’d love to hear from you. Build, deploy, and manage PostgreSQL databases in production environments. Develop and optimize database schemas, queries, and procedures for performance and scalability. Develop and maintain database tooling for automation, monitoring, and performance tuning. Optimize database performance, indexing strategies, and query tuning. Implement high availability, backup, and disaster recovery solutions. Work closely with Infrastructure and Applications teams to integrate database tools. Implement proactive solutions using observability tools to monitor database health. Desirable Skills, Knowledge, and Experience

Experience building large multi-tenant databases, capacity planning, failover design, fault tolerance, and disaster recovery. Experience building and maintaining database tooling for automation and monitoring. Experience optimizing database performance and query tuning. Experience with alerting and monitoring tools such as Prometheus, Grafana, and Kibana. Experience in scripting languages (Python, Bash) for automation. Experience with infrastructure-as-code (Terraform, Ansible or Salt). Nice-to-Have Skills

Expertise in database schema migrations and automation using Flyway, Liquibase or Goose. Experience with Docker and Kubernetes. Contributions to PostgreSQL or relevant open-source projects. Experience with connection pooling solutions such as PgBouncer, HAProxy. Experience with non-relational data stores (e.g., distributed and time-series databases like Cassandra, Timescale) and key-value stores (Redis). Experience developing software in Go, Python or C/C++. Compensation and Benefits

Compensation may be adjusted based on work location. Example ranges: Washington, D.C. based hires: $154,000–$188,000 per year. This role is eligible to participate in Cloudflare’s equity plan. Cloudflare offers a comprehensive benefits package including health, dental, vision, FSA, commuter benefits, fertility and family-forming benefits, mental health support, and more. Details vary by location. Equal Opportunity

Cloudflare is proud to be an equal opportunity employer. All qualified applicants will be considered for employment without regard to race, color, religion, sex, gender, gender identity or expression, sexual orientation, national origin, ancestry, citizenship, age, disability, medical condition, family care status, or any other basis protected by law. We are AA/Veterans/Disabled Employer. Reasonable accommodations are available on request. This position may require access to information protected under U.S. export control laws. Employment eligibility may be conditioned on authorization to receive software or technology controlled under U.S. export laws without sponsorship for an export license.

#J-18808-Ljbffr